Meaning:

Seifert is variant form of Sever. One with a grave and austere demeanor.

Descendant of Sigifrith meaning "victory, peace".

Lastname is variation of Sievers. Descendant of Sigiwart meaning "victory, worthy".

Surname is the variation of Siveyer. A maker of sieves, whence also Sivewright.

Despite the fact that the number of Seifert bearers increased by 1 per cent in 2010 US census to 10499 since 2000, the surname slipped by 239 spots and ranked at 3408. The last name was found in around 4 per hundred thousand population. Please refer to following table for race and ethnicity.

Race 2010 2000
White 95.32 96.96
Hispanic or Latino 2.51 1.26
Others 1.1 0.83
Asian and Native Hawaiian
& Other Pacific Islander
0.59 0.46
Black 0.34 0.28
American Indian and Alaska Native 0.13 0.21

Immigrants to US

From Germany

M. Seifert hailed from Germany. 24 years old embarked for USA from Havre on Woodside and arrived on September 2, 1852. Peter Seifert (18) Farmer, 18 years old Peter Seifert, 24 years old Georges Seifert, Fritz Seifert (39) Farmer, 19 years old Cathrine Seifert, Eva Seifert, Marguerite Seifert (21) Farmer, Michel Seifert, aged 16, and 1012 other Seifert around 39.05% of whom were farmer while others worked as smith and laborer, tailor, miller, cultivator, cooper, gardener, merchant, servant, joiner, weaver, seamstress, shoemaker, brewer, bookseller, carpenter, daughter, undefined code, glass worker, butcher, clerk, barber, bricklayer, cabinet maker, waiter, cook, drover, engineer, saddler, stone cutter, spinster, baker, painter, miner, mason, tourist migrated to US.
